The FailureMessageAccessor type exposes the following members.
Methods
Name | Description | |
---|---|---|
![]() | CloneFailureMessage |
Creates a copy of the FailureMessage.
|
![]() | Dispose | Releases all resources used by the FailureMessageAccessor |
![]() | Equals | Determines whether the specified Object is equal to the current Object. (Inherited from Object.) |
![]() | GetAdditionalElementIds |
Retrieves Ids of Elements that have not caused the failure but are related to it
Checks if the failure has resolution of a given resolution type.
|
![]() | GetCurrentResolutionType |
Retrieves the type of resolution to be used to resolve the failure.
|
![]() | GetDefaultResolutionCaption |
Retrieves the caption of default resolution of the failure.
|
![]() | GetDescriptionText |
Retrieves the description of the failure.
|
![]() | GetFailingElementIds |
Retrieves Ids of Elements that have caused the failure.
|
![]() | GetFailureDefinitionId |
Retrieves the Id of the FailureDefinition of the failure.
|
![]() | GetHashCode | Serves as a hash function for a particular type. (Inherited from Object.) |
![]() | GetNumberOfResolutions |
Retrieves number of resolutions that can be used to resolve failure.
|
![]() | GetSeverity |
Retrieves the severity of the failure.
|
![]() | GetType | Gets the Type of the current instance. (Inherited from Object.) |
![]() | HasResolutionOfType |
Checks if failure has a resolution of a given type.
|
![]() | HasResolutions |
Checks if the failure has any resolutions.
|
![]() | SetCurrentResolutionType |
Sets the type of a resolution to be used to resolve the failure.
|
![]() | ShouldMergeWithMessage |
Checks if the FailureMessage should be merged with the other FailureMessage for better user experience.
|
![]() | ToString | Returns a string that represents the current object. (Inherited from Object.) |
